• Thales EFB hardware solution is an evolutive system enabling to securely mount your current and future EFB during all flight phase. Thales mounting solution was designed to accommodate most common EFB tablets today and in the future with no impact on STC. Indeed, consumer tablets are evolving quickly, in terms of shape, voltage supply… much faster than your willingness to modify the Supplemental Type Certicate (STC)!

• With Thales EFB hardware solution you can mount your iPad in your cockpits today then switch to a Windows operating system tablet or to the Thales Pad. Adding the Aircraft Interface Device (AID), you will be able to connect your EFB to the aircraft, extend to its capabilities.

DC CONVERTER

Input 28V DC

Output 19V DCup to 4.2 Amps

Efficiency 90% typical

Temperature Operating: -55°C to +70°C (-67°F to 158°F)Non-operating: -62°C to +95°C

Altitude 55,000 feet

Compliance FAA TSO-C71

Environment DO-160F

Weight 0.56 Lbs (254 Grams)

Size 1.56 H x 2.25 W x 5 L inches39.6 H x 57 W x 127 L mm

Part Number LT-46(M)
